When you spot a wedge pattern forming on a price chart, it indicates a period of consolidation and a potential breakout in the near future. To use wedges effectively, you should wait for the price to break out of the wedge pattern before taking any trading actions. A breakout above the upper trend line of a falling wedge suggests a bullish trend reversal, while a breakout below the lower trend line of a rising wedge indicates a bearish trend reversal. It's important to set stop-loss orders to manage risk and protect your capital in case the breakout fails. Remember, wedges are just one tool in your trading arsenal, so always consider other factors and indicators before making trading decisions.
